What to Expect

A Kashmir tour can be an amazing experience as the region is known for its breathtaking natural beauty, rich history, vibrant culture, and warm hospitality. Here are some things you can expect from a Kashmir tour:

  • Scenic landscapes: Kashmir is known for its stunning landscapes including snow-capped mountains, crystal clear lakes, verdant meadows, and beautiful valleys. You can expect to be mesmerized by the natural beauty of the region and capture some incredible photographs.
  • Rich culture: Kashmir has a rich and diverse culture influenced by its history and geography. You can expect to experience the local music, dance, food, and traditions of the region, which are a blend of Persian, Central Asian, and Indian cultures.
  • Adventure activities: Kashmir offers many adventure activities such as skiing, trekking, rafting, paragliding, and mountaineering. You can expect to enjoy these activities and experience an adrenaline rush.
  • Historical landmarks: Kashmir has a rich history dating back to ancient times, and you can expect to explore some historical landmarks such as Mughal Gardens, Jama Masjid, and Shankaracharya Temple.
  • Warm hospitality: The people of Kashmir are known for their warm hospitality and welcoming nature. You can expect to be treated with respect and kindness, and enjoy the local hospitality and cuisine.

Itinerary

Day 1Arrival in Srinagar

Arrive at Srinagar airport and meet your tour operator. Transfer to your hotel and check-in. Spend the day relaxing and acclimatizing to the altitude.

Day 2Srinagar Sightseeing

After breakfast, go on a sightseeing tour of Srinagar. Visit the famous Mughal Gardens of Nishat Bagh, Shalimar Bagh, and Chashme Shahi. Take a shikara ride on the iconic Dal Lake. Return to the hotel for dinner and overnight stay.

Day 3Srinagar to Gulmarg

After breakfast, proceed to Gulmarg, which is about 56 km from Srinagar. On the way, stop at the famous Tangmarg market for some shopping. Reach Gulmarg and check-in to your hotel. Spend the rest of the day at leisure.

Day 4Gulmarg Sightseeing

After breakfast, enjoy a day of sightseeing in Gulmarg. Take a gondola ride to the top of the Apharwat Peak for stunning views of the Himalayas. Enjoy skiing, snowboarding, and other adventure activities at the ski resort. Return to the hotel for dinner and overnight stay.

Day 5Gulmarg to Pahalgam

After breakfast, drive to Pahalgam, which is about 150 km from Gulmarg. On the way, visit the famous Awantipora ruins and the saffron fields at Pampore. Reach Pahalgam and check-in to your hotel. Spend the rest of the day at leisure.

Day 6Departure

After breakfast, check-out of the hotel and proceed to the Srinagar airport for your onward journey.
